
l. Control In Settings Page (Mainframe, C-001T)
The CONTROL IN Settings Page allows programming for the Contact Controllers
connected to the Contact IN 1-4, 2-wire connections on the 9000 mainframe’s rear
panel & the 5-12 Inputs on the C-001T. A custom dry contact switch or a ZM-9003
controller may be assigned to the following functions:
1. Parameter
Selects the control function assigned to that contact:
•
LOAD BANK
(MIXER Mode): Loads the selected preset SCENE memory
•
EVENT
(MATRIX Mode): Activates an EVENT broadcast.
•
VOLUME UP:
Incrementally controls the upward volume
•
VOLUME DOWN:
Incrementally controls the downward volume
•
POWER:
Powers up the 9000 unit from STANDBY operation.
•
MUTE:
Mutes the assigned INPUT or OUTPUT
•
EMERGENCY MUTE
: MUTES ALL AUDIO
•
BGM END
(MATRIX-BGM/PAGE Sub mode): Ends all BGM source broadcasts.
•
CHANNEL ON
(MIXER Mode): Turns ON the assigned INPUT or OUTPUT
2.
Selects the
Preset Memory
or
Channel #
if Volume, LOAD BANK, MUTE or CHANNEL
ON is selected in #1.
3.
Sets the
dB steps
for volume if VOLUME UP/DOWN is selected in #1.
4.
Activates a Controller Output (1-12) to be sent simultaneously with activation of that
Control IN. This function may be used to facilitate triggering various coordinated events,
such as emergency lighting, announcements, cameras, access control, etc…
5.
A direct link to the
CONTROL OUT
settings Page.

In MATRIX Mode: The EVENT setting cannot be accessed from this page.
When an EVENT is programmed to be activated by a Contact Input in the EVENT
Settings Page, that status will then be indicated in the Remote Settings Page.
